Not a Great Time to Be an Artist

Top financier predicts sharp downturn in market

By Eleanor Villforth,  Newser User

Posted Apr 3, 2008 5:50 PM CDT

(Newser) – The exploding art market may be about to deflate: New York’s flurry of contemporary art fairs last week had surprisingly good sales in light of the economic times, reports Portfolio, but the president of one of the nation’s most active lenders against art...   Read full story »
